Affiliate Script Aren’t Just For Affiliates
What can you do if you want to know which promotion is successful and which is not? Maybe you’ve heard of click tracking. Click tracking systems are good to see which ads are bringing in the traffic, but you can’t really know which traffic is making the sale.
Now why would we want to know which traffic is bringing in the sales? With my blueprint site, I found a few forums that I can advertise in. Let’s say that I bought some ad spots in two forums. And let say from all that, I get 1000 unique visitors and 50 sales. And let say that the traffic are equal from each site, 500 unique visitors from each…
Think about this … we know we have 50 sales, but we don’t know which traffic is giving the sales. In the end, you still don’t know which advertising investment is more profitable. Was it advertising in forum A, or forum B?
Here’s a scary thought — what if all that 50 sales were from forum A, and forum B didn’t bring any sale at all. The more scary part is — you have no idea. If you do, you could’ve just stop advertising in forum B, right?
So this is where the affiliate script comes in. If I installed an affiliate script, and track all of my advertising using this script, I can know which advertising is bringing in the sales. If you’ve run an affiliate program, you should be able to know which affiliate is bring in the sales, right?
With advertising, you just treat your advertising partners as your affiliate. The difference is that your advertising partners do not get paid commissions. You pay them for the ad spots.
Let say that you want to advertise in forum A. You just create an affiliate account for forum A and use the affiliate link to advertise in forum A. Of course, the owner (or webmaster) of forum A doesn’t really have to know.
When you want to advertise, you just give the webmaster the affiliate link and the banner. You just say that it’s for tracking.
Now, when forum A brings in traffic - you know. And when forum A makes a sale - you know too.
